Output 958636de52537716875cd4bcc1c7daf415a206f6b0b351dda7d6de1bf1539996:14

value
199680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af16c559ded123bb9ab42e084ac996d2138f52 OP_EQUAL
address
38Vug8eU4Ea3MMx9NcRj9kxrz2h5Yub1Uz
transaction
958636de52537716875cd4bcc1c7daf415a206f6b0b351dda7d6de1bf1539996
confirmations
397517
spent
true